About Susana Devesa
Susana Devesa is a scholar working on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Ceramics and Composites and Materials Chemistry, having authored 42 papers that have together received 287 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(18 papers), Microwave Dielectric Ceramics Synthesis (13 papers) and Multiferroics and related materials (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Materials Chemistry (183 cit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(69 citations) and Polymers and Plastics (32 citations). Susana Devesa has collaborated with scholars based in Portugal, Tunisia and France. Frequent co-authors include L. C. Costa, M.P.F. Graça, David Cooper, Aidan P. Rooney, F. Henry, S. Carvalho, Paulo André, Zohra Benzarti, S. Soreto Teixeira and F.A.M.M. Gonçalves. Their work appears in journals such as Sensors, International Journal of Biological Macromolecules and Colloids and Surfaces A Physicochemical and Engineering Aspects.
